At the center of cannabis crops' nutritional profile are their seeds, usually called hemp hearts when hulled. These little powerhouses from Cannabis sativa are brimming with complete proteins, that contains all 9 essential amino acids that your body are not able to make By itself. A single ounce of hemp seeds delivers about ten grams of protein, earning them a great option for vegans and athletes alike. Unlike several plant-centered proteins, the bioavailability of amino acids in cannabis seeds is higher, making certain successful absorption. This nutritional edge positions cannabis crops as being a sustainable protein source, Specially as world demand for plant proteins surges amid climate considerations in excess of animal agriculture.

Diet from cannabis crops extends considerably further than protein. Hemp seeds are among the richest sources of omega-3 and omega-six fatty acids, putting an optimal one:three ratio that is exceptional in mother nature and mirrors your body's great desires for anti-inflammatory Gains. These polyunsaturated fats, particularly alpha-linolenic acid (ALA), support coronary heart health and fitness by decreasing terrible cholesterol degrees and cutting down the chance of cardiovascular disease. Scientific studies in the Journal of Agricultural and Meals Chemistry emphasize how common intake of cannabis seed oil can boost lipid profiles, making it a staple in purposeful foods and health supplements. For anyone focused on Mind wellness, these essential fatty acids nourish neural tissues, likely warding off cognitive decrease related to aging.

Natural vitamins and minerals more elevate the nutritional price of cannabis plants. Hemp seeds boast superior levels of vitamin E, a strong antioxidant that safeguards cells from oxidative worry, and magnesium, which aids muscle peace and rest high-quality. They're also loaded with phosphorus for bone energy, zinc for immune function, and iron to battle anemia. A 2020 evaluation in Nutrients journal emphasised how these micronutrients in cannabis-derived foods add to All round wellness, significantly in populations with dietary deficiencies. Leaves and flowers of cannabis vegetation, though significantly less usually consumed on account of different THC content material in marijuana strains, present chlorophyll, fiber, and extra antioxidants like beta-carotene, adding layers to their nutritional arsenal.

The nutritional flexibility of cannabis plants shines in modern day Delicacies. Hemp seed butter spreads like nut butter on toast, offering sustained Power devoid of blood sugar spikes. Cannabis seed oil attire salads, its nutty flavor improving greens even though furnishing GLA (gamma-linolenic acid) for skin wellness. In baking, floor hemp seeds switch flour in gluten-totally free recipes, boosting fiber intake to 10 grams for each ounce and supporting digestive regularity. Marijuana lovers experiment with infused edibles, but diet industry experts advocate for hemp-concentrated goods to harness Rewards with no intoxication. Protein smoothies Mixing cannabis seeds with berries and spinach exemplify how these vegetation integrate seamlessly into day-to-day diet strategies.
